WebAug 25, 2024 · If you’ve been married for less than two years at the time of filing, you’ll be provided a conditional green card. This is true for green cards issued via consular processing as well. You can convert it to a permanent green card after two years by filing a petition. Read More. WebFor unmarried, adult children of green card holders, the process may take 8-9 years. However, if you are a citizen of the Philippines, it may take 10+ years, and if you are a citizen of Mexico, it may take 20+ years. For married, adult children of U.S. citizens, the immigrant visa application process may take 13-14 years.
